Shave Date 3/7/2024
DE:
1948 Gillette Super Speed TTO
Blade: Dorco Titan (2)
Pre-Shave: PAA The Cube 2.0
Soap: Goodfellas Smile Furiah
Brush: Zenith 507-IF Italian Flag.
Post-Shave: Alum block, Thayer's Witch Hazel, Momma Bears Winter Post-Shave Balm, Canoe EDT Splash
Rating: 29/30 10 for Comfort, 10 for cuts and weepers(0), 9 for smoothness, neck stubble, BBS face, just shy of BBS on the neck.

Notes:

The timing for my shaves during Lent is such that DE shaves are easier to fit into the schedule than straight razor shaves. I have begun to journal more in the morning to capture my thoughts and feelings after the Lenten morning meditations and I will put the straights on a slight hiatus till Lent is over.

I did have more blade feel with the Super Speed than I did with the Yates I used yesterday, there was no blood today but those sea lions were ran off the dock again today. Just as yesterday, they left a tad bit of fur behind, and the dolphins are swimming with glee out in the bay. All is good in the land. The neck and jawline are up there with the best of my shaves, and the cheeks are BBS. I need to be cautious with my chasing of BBS on the neck, I found myself striving for the complete removal of the sea lions today by doing extra passes. I was fortunate today that I did not get any irritation, as before I used to get neck irritation if I chased BBS too much.

My DE shaves are just three passes and clean-up, whereas the straights do 4 passes and any needed clean-up. My DE shaves are one N-S on everything, One right ear to left ear on everything, and one S-N on everything. I do clean-up on the neck with a diagonal pass from the right to the left side, sorta in between a true XTG and ATG pass for the neck. It seems to clean it up as well as an ATG pass does on the neck. I did chase ATG today on the neck and luckily I did not get any irritation.

Canoe is a blast from the past, I remember this scent in high school. But it seems that the scent isn't as strong as it was back in the day, or my sense of smell is still compromised either way, the scent isn't that much stronger than some of my aftershaves. But it's a good one.

I need to start an analog journal of my DE shaves as I have for my straights and keep better track of the metrics. With just two blades used thus far after bringing the DE out of retirement, the Lord Super Stainless ranks higher than the Dorco Titan. I was pleasantly surprised with how good the Lord Super Stainless was. I will not refer to the other highly regarded blade, the one I was on the fast track to Bishop status that was derailed by the straights, I'll say the Lord can stand toe to toe with any of them. This is good news as their factory is still cranking out blades. The Dorco is not that far behind the Lord blade, just a hair behind, both are excellent blades and have delivered some of the best shaves I have had ever.
